Ralphie May's widow Lahna Turner produces and directs her first feature documentary. April 2024, 24 minutes


Come What May begins as a film about legendary comedian Ralphie May’s weight-loss journey but evolves into something far more profound—a raw and moving exploration of addiction, love, and codependency. Through years of footage and emotional storytelling, widow Lahna Turner crafts a unique hybrid of documentary and biography that reveals the complexities behind a larger-than-life performer. In this candid conversation, Turner shares the decade-long journey of bringing the film to life, the challenges of independent filmmaking, and her innovative approach to distribution—taking the film directly to audiences across the country.
